如何在Java中使用函数:简单的函数示例
在Java中,函数也称为方法。函数是用于处理一定的任务和返回结果的代码块。函数可以被其他程序或代码片段调用,同时也可以接收参数和返回值。
下面展示一个简单的Java函数示例来帮助了解如何在Java中使用函数:
public class SimpleFunctionExample {
public static void main(String[] args) {
int num1 = 5;
int num2 = 10;
int result = sum(num1, num2);
System.out.println("The result is: " + result);
}
public static int sum(int num1, int num2) {
int sum = num1 + num2;
return sum;
}
}
这段代码定义了一个简单的函数sum,该函数返回两个整数的和。这个函数名字为sum,接收两个整数类型的参数:num1和num2。
在main函数中,我们定义了两个整数类型变量num1和num2,并将它们传递给sum函数。sum函数计算这两个数的和,并将结果返回给main函数。main函数中的result变量接收这个返回的结果,最后将结果打印出来。
示例中定义的函数可以通过以下步骤来使用:
1. 定义函数:定义函数的名称,参数和返回类型。
2. 在函数定义后的代码块中编写函数的实现。
3. 在另一个函数中调用该函数并传递所需的参数。
4. 执行被调用的函数,并接收返回值。
可以在Java中使用以下方式来定义函数:
<访问修饰符> <返回类型> <函数名>(<参数列表>) {
//函数体
return <返回值>;
}
- 访问修饰符:
Java中的访问修饰符有四种:
1. public:表示该函数可以被程序的任何部分调用,其作用域是公共的。
2. private:表示该函数只能被定义它的类所调用,其作用域是私有的。
3. protected:表示该函数可以被定义它的类及其子类所调用,其作用域是受保护的。
4. 默认:如果没有指定函数访问修饰符,则使用默认级别,表示该函数只能被同一个包中的其他类所调用。
- 返回类型:
函数可以返回任何类型的数据。如果函数返回值为空,则返回类型为void。
- 函数名:
函数的名称是用于调用该函数的标识符。
- 参数:
参数是传递到函数的值,可以有任意数量的参数。如果函数不需要参数,则括号内为空。
- 函数体:
函数体包含了函数的所有代码。
- 返回值:
返回值是从函数中返回的值,如果函数没有返回值,则返回类型应该是void。
通过这个例子,我们可以看出Java函数的基本定义、访问修饰符、参数和返回值的使用方法。这是Java编程的基础,并且这种方法可以帮助你更有效地编写代码,从而更好地解决问题。
